Understanding Ethical Sourcing in Balinese Rotancraft

Ethical sourcing in Bali rotancraft encompasses several critical elements:

  • Sustainable Harvesting: Rotan is a renewable resource, but its harvesting must be managed responsibly. This means selecting mature canes, employing selective cutting techniques, and ensuring reforestation efforts. Shops committed to ethics often partner directly with communities that manage rotan forests sustainably.
  • Fair Labour Practices: Artisans are the heart of Bali rotancraft. Ethical shops ensure fair wages, safe working conditions, and respect for traditional crafting techniques. This often involves direct employment or long-term partnerships with artisan collectives, bypassing exploitative intermediaries.
  • Environmental Stewardship: Beyond sustainable harvesting, ethical producers minimise their environmental footprint through eco-friendly finishing processes, waste reduction, and avoiding harmful chemicals. This contributes to the creation of truly eco friendly rattan furniture Bali.
  • Community Engagement: Many ethical enterprises actively reinvest in local communities through educational programmes, healthcare initiatives, or infrastructure development, fostering long-term prosperity.

Identifying Reputable Bali Rotancraft Shops

When searching for ethically sourced Bali rotancraft, consider the following:

  • Transparency: Look for shops that are open about their sourcing, production methods, and artisan relationships. Websites or in-store information should detail their ethical policies.
  • Certifications & Affiliations: While not always universal for smaller artisans, some larger ethical suppliers may have certifications related to sustainable forestry or fair trade. Membership in recognised ethical trade organisations is also a positive indicator.
  • Artisan Stories: Shops that feature the stories of their artisans, their craft, and their communities often indicate a deeper, more respectful relationship with their workforce.
  • Product Quality & Durability: Ethically made items are typically crafted with care and designed to last, reflecting the value placed on both materials and labour. This is particularly true for items like Bali rattan dining furniture, which requires robust construction.

What makes rattan furniture ‘sustainable’ in the Balinese context?

Balinese rattan furniture is considered sustainable when the raw rattan is harvested responsibly from managed forests, allowing for regeneration. Additionally, the sustainability extends to fair treatment of artisans, minimal environmental impact during production, and the creation of durable pieces that reduce the need for frequent replacement.

How can I verify a Bali rotancraft shop’s ethical claims?

To verify ethical claims, examine the shop’s website for detailed information on their sourcing policies, artisan remuneration, and environmental initiatives. Look for photos or stories about their workshops and craftsmen. You can also inquire directly about their practices, such as how they ensure fair wages or their rattan’s origin. Independent certifications, where present, offer additional assurance.
